Late to this, but the trick is to sketch sketch sketch. The confident, long lines will come eventually. Instead of trying to draw long lines, try making similar shapes but with short strokes. Try not to drag your stylus across the canvas without releasing it for longer than a second. It's gonna look like shit, but it will teach you familiarity with the pencil. Eventually you will also learn to master the confident, longer strokes. Another tip would be to keep tracing and tracing and tracing over your own layers until it looks good. Keep practicing, you'll get there.

The concept of "being ongezellig" is mostly about being the only one not going along or not being as engaged as the rest within the context of social plans or situations. When someone suggests "let's go do x thing" and one person goes "I don't think I'll go" they will be told "oh come on, don't be so ongezellig". "The whole family will be there, don't be ongezellig and join us". Being on your phone in company is also "ongezellig". So is not saying much or don't looking dramatically happy while the rest is chatting/doing whatever the occasion is. Being gezellig, so the opposite of ongezellig, means being present, actively involved, part of the group and overall sociable. So sociable works as a translation, but the Dutch culture of "not allowing people to do their own thing or being introverted within a group" is kind of an extra layer to that expression. That's why Maya is ongezellig for not joining Coco and Mymy with their board game, for sitting alone during breaks while the rest is in groups, for running when Coco wants to "gezellig"-ly do something together etc.
